India, Feb. 24 -- Getting dressed in space comes with its own set of challenges, but NASA astronaut Don Pettit has found a unique way to put on his pants-by diving into them mid-air. In a video shared on February 21, the veteran astronaut demonstrated his unconventional dressing technique aboard the International Space Station (ISS), leaving viewers both amazed and amused.

Rather than following the usual one-leg-at-a-time method, Pettit descended straight into his floating trousers, effectively jumping into them with both legs at once. He captioned the video with a simple yet fitting phrase: "Two legs at a time."
